BLT Sandwich

  • Prep Time
    5 MINS
  • Cook Time
    10 MINS
  • KCals 440
  • Carbs 13G
1 Serving

Ingredients

  • 3 slices wholemeal bread taken from a 400g loaf
  • 2 bacon medallions
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 medium sized tomato sliced
  • 2 lettuce leaves
  • 1 tbsp tomato ketchup
  • 1 tbsp lighter than light mayonnaise
  • low calorie cooking spray

Instructions

  1. First weigh the 3 slices of bread. If it is over 60g cut off some of the crust from 1 slice and weigh it again, until you get 60g.

  2. Spray a frying pan with low calorie cooking spray and cook the bacon and eggs. You'll want the eggs quite hard so they don't make a mess when you eat the BLT.

  3. If you want, you can toast the bread at this point.

  4. Lay out the bread with the slice you cut the crust off in the middle.

  5. Spread half of the ketchup onto one of the bigger slices of bread then place the eggs on top. Spread a little of the light mayo onto one side of the smaller slice of bread and stack on-top of the ketchup and egg slice.

  6. Spread the top piece of bread with a little more of the mayo, then add the bacon, sliced tomato and lettuce. Put the remaining mayo on the last piece of bread.

  7. Place this slice on top of the lettuce and cut the sandwich in half diagonally. Enjoy!
